Break-glass access: orders soft deletes (Merrowbase Platform). Plugin authors cannot hard-delete rows; soft-deleted orders keep a deleted_at timestamp and vanish from standard queries. Restoring a soft-deleted order normally goes through the partner console. In emergencies — corruption, mass accidental deletion — break-glass access lets you query deleted rows directly on the replica. Use is audited and expires after one hour. The break-glass session unlocks only with the duty account's recovery passphrase, which follows on the next line.

unlock words, yawig-kagef: gordor-holvan-ulaael-pramir-ulaiel-tamdor

Handing off the Quillbeam firmware channel. Stable channel is frozen until the radio regression is fixed; beta channel is fine. If a customer device is stuck mid-update, do not force a retry — escalate instead, since repeated retries can brick the bootloader on older units. Rollbacks go through the channel console only. Escalation steps and the stuck-device checklist are on the internal page below.

dashboard of haweg-yaguf = https://confluence.tolvaqlabs.internal/browse/browse/display/77f0a7ad

Subject: Insurance renewal — action needed

Exec team,

Our combined liability and property policy with Merrowgate Assurance renews next month. Premium is up 18% on last year, driven by the Halden Quay warehouse revaluation and two small claims. Broker has tabled an alternative from Corvel Mutual at a 6% saving but with a higher excess. Recommendation: stay with Merrowgate, negotiate the excess, revisit at mid-term. Incoming director should own this from renewal date. Context on why this matters strategically is in the note below.

internal memo for bahap-yagug: Headcount on the Ulaix team goes from 3 to 100 by the end of January. Gross margin on Ulaix came in at 10 percent against a plan of 15 percent.

# Websocket reconnect bug — context for new hires.
# The Corvid gateway drops idle websocket sessions after 90 seconds,
# and older clients fail to replay their subscription state on
# reconnect, leaving dashboards frozen until a hard refresh. The fix
# persists subscription snapshots server-side so reconnects can
# restore state transparently. Those snapshots live in the session
# store, which this service must reach on startup. Configure access
# with the connection string below.

replica DSN, kajep-yahag: mssql://praok_svc:iF@db-8d68.plorvaio.local:5432/eliion